How long does generator installation take in Blanton?

Most residential generator installations take one to two days depending on your property setup and generator size. The first day typically involves preparing the concrete pad, running electrical connections, and setting the generator. Day two covers final electrical connections, testing, and system commissioning. Weather can affect timeline, especially during concrete curing, but we’ll give you a realistic schedule upfront and keep you informed of any changes.
Generator sizing depends on your home’s electrical load, not just square footage. We calculate based on your essential appliances, HVAC system, and electrical panel capacity. Most homes need between 16-24 kW for whole house coverage, but larger homes with electric heat or multiple AC units might need more. We’ll perform a load calculation during the estimate to determine exactly what you need without oversizing and wasting money.

Installation costs vary based on generator size, electrical work needed, and site preparation requirements. Most residential installations range from $3,000 to $6,000 for labor, plus the generator cost. Factors like distance from your electrical panel, gas line requirements, and concrete work affect the final price. We provide detailed estimates that break down all costs so you know exactly what you’re paying for before work begins.
Standby generators need annual maintenance to stay reliable when you need them. This includes oil changes, filter replacements, and system testing. Most generators run automatic self-tests weekly, but professional maintenance ensures everything stays in working order. We can set up a maintenance schedule or recommend qualified service providers. Regular maintenance protects your warranty and prevents failures during actual outages when you’re counting on backup power.
